Subject: [dpdk-dev] [PATCH v2 1/6] ethdev: remove unused kernel driver field
Date: Mon, 14 Sep 2020 10:23:45 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200914082350.13279-2-david.marchand@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200914082350.13279-1-david.marchand@redhat.com>

This field was not generic as it was filled with PCI kernel drivers only.
It has no known in-tree user (and I could not find opensource projects
using it).
